The role

The American Red Cross is hiring a Phlebotomist to assist with the blood collection process by managing equipment, creating a welcoming environment for donors, and ensuring all regulatory safety procedures are followed. This role provides paid training, making it accessible for those without prior medical experience, and involves travel to various mobile blood drive locations. Candidates will work a variable schedule to support community donation needs, requiring flexibility in working hours including early mornings, weekends, and holidays.

What you'll do

  • Personally connect with donors to create a welcoming environment
  • Collaborate with teammates to transport and set up equipment at collection sites
  • Follow safety procedures to ensure blood meets regulatory requirements
  • Operate Red Cross vehicles to travel to mobile drive locations

What it takes

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Customer service experience and strong verbal communication skills
  • Current, valid driver's license with a good driving record
  • Ability to lift, push, or pull heavy weights
  • Minimum height of 60 inches to safely operate Red Cross vehicles

Frequently asked questions

Is previous medical experience required for this Phlebotomist role?

No, the American Red Cross provides paid training for this position, so no prior medical or phlebotomy experience is required.

What is the work schedule for this position?

The role requires a variable schedule that may include early mornings, late nights, weekends, and holidays, with shifts typically set two to three weeks in advance.

What is the compensation for this job?

The approved rate of pay for this position is $21.33 per hour.

Are there specific physical requirements for the job?

Yes, candidates must be at least 60 inches tall to operate company vehicles and must be able to lift, push, or pull heavy equipment and stand or sit for long periods.
